John Huser, 84, of Sioux City, passed away Thursday, July 24, 2014 at a local care facility. Funeral services will be 1:00 P.M. Tuesday, July 29, 2014 at Meyer Brothers Morningside Chapel. Visitation will be one hour prior to the service time. Burial will be at Memorial Park Cemetery. Online condolences can be directed to meyerbroschapels.com. John was born the son of John and Sena (Jacobson) Huser on July 23, 1930 in Sioux City, Iowa. He received his education in Sioux City and graduated from Sioux City East High School. John married Shirley Schreiber on October 24th, 1954 in Sioux City. John worked for McCracken-Concrete Pipe Company for many years where he retired as sales manager. John enjoyed fishing and golfing. He honorably served his country in the United States Navy during the Korean conflict. John is survived by four sons, David (Mara) Huser of Sioux Falls, South Dakota, Dan (Geri) Huser of Altoona, Iowa, Tim (Linda) Huser of Eugene, Oregon, and Steve (Diane) Huser of Kona, Hawaii; one daughter, Laura (Jim) Gerrish of Dighton, Massachusetts; two brothers, Al Huser of Sioux City and Art (Kay) Huser of Sioux City; one daughter-in-law, Deb Huser of Sergeant Bluff, Iowa; seven grandchildren; and four great-grandchildren. He was preceded in death by his parents; wife, Shirley; son, Randy; and brother Don.
